Transaction ab17373eba25dac61588c5cadd3c597b4703332389ed1b7f125805e5b50bf6e9

block
85394a13535e195fa74e79a3572db83c1d6154b5594d6d45bb503dfaadc4ffe8

1 Input

24 Outputs